Jill's Christmas Cut-Out Cookies

I didn't realize that there were other cut-out recipes until I had Jill's. I'd always just had my mom's. So when I tasted Jill's that were thicker and softer, I was amazed ... and I love them! 

Jill's Christmas Cut-Outs

1/2 cup Margarine
3/4 cup Sugar
1 Egg
1/2 tsp Vanilla
1 3/4 cup Flour
1/4 tsp Salt
1/2 tsp Baking Soda
1/2 tsp Baking Powder
2 - 3 Tbsp Milk

Mix first four ingredients and then gradually add dry ingredients. Add milk. Chill until firm.

Roll to 1/4" thickness on a floured surface. Bake at 350 degrees for 6 - 8 minutes on a greased cookie sheet. Cool and then frost with a buttercream frosting.

Gingerbread Men

These are the best gingerbread cookies EVER ... thanks to Jill Wirth for sharing!

Gingerbread Men

1 cup Shortening
1 cup Sugar
1 Egg
1 cup Molasses (dark)
2 Tbsp. Vinegar
5 cups Flour
1 1/2 tsp Baking Soda
1/2 tsp Salt
2 - 3 tsp ground Ginger
1 tsp Cinnamon
1 tsp ground Cloves

Preheat oven to 375 degrees.

Cream shortening and sugar and then beat in egg, molasses, and vinegar. Blend in dry ingredients. Chill 3 hours. Roll dough out to about 1/4" thick on lightly floured surface. Cut out shapes and placed on greased cookie sheet. Bake at 375 for 5 - 6 minutes. Cool slightly and remove to rack. Decorate as desired!
